Lument Finance Trust Inc (LFT) USD0.01

Sell:$1.40Buy:$1.41Price increased$0.11 (8.08%)

Prices delayed by at least 15 minutes
Sell:$1.40
Buy:$1.41
Change:Price increased$0.11 (8.08%)
Prices delayed by at least 15 minutes
Sell:$1.40
Buy:$1.41
Change:Price increased$0.11 (8.08%)
Prices delayed by at least 15 minutes